Find this useful? Enter your email to receive occasional updates for securing PHP code.

Signing you up...

Thank you for signing up!

PHP Decode

eval(gzinflate(base64_decode('DVZF0oRqsl1O3xsMcCiiowcU7g4Fkxe4O3zI6t+/gjyZx7IE6fBP/bZTNaRH..

Decoded Output download


require_once($_SERVER[DOCUMENT_ROOT]."/INC/dbconf.php"); class mydb { private $mysqli; private $host; private $user; private $pw; private $db; function __construct ($dbCon ) { $this->host = $dbCon['dbHost']; $this->user = $dbCon['dbUid'] ; $this->pw = $dbCon['dbPw'] ; $this->db = $dbCon['db'] ; } function __destruct() { $this->db_close(); } function connect() { try { $this->mysqli = new mysqli ("$this->host", "$this->user", "$this->pw", "$this->db" ); if (!$this->mysqli){ throw new Exception("Could not connect to the MySQL server."); }else { if($dbCon['charset']) $this->mysqli->set_charset($dbCon['charset']); } } catch( Exception $con_error ) { echo($con_error->getMessage()); } } function tran_query ($query) { $this->connect(); $this->mysqli->autocommit(false); for($i=0; $i<count($query); $i++) { $this->rs = @mysqli_query($this->mysqli,$query[$i]); if ( $this->mysqli-> error ) { break; } } if ( $this->mysqli-> error ) { $this->mysqli->rollback(); return "0"; } else { $this->mysqli->commit(); return "1" ; } } function query($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); if( $this->rs ) return $this->rs; else echo mysqli_error($this->mysqli); } function fetch_array($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$tempArray = array(); $i=0; while( $data = @mysqli_fetch_array( $this->rs ) ) { $tempArray[$i] = $data ; $i++; } return $tempArray ; } function select_one($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= $this->rs->fetch_row(); return $row[0]; } function get_once($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= $this->rs->fetch_row(); return $row[0]; } function fetch($result) { $this->connect(); return @mysqli_fetch_assoc($result); } function selectList($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); if( !$this->rs ) { echo $query." : ERROR : ".mysqli_error($this->mysqli); return; } $tempArray = array(); $i=0; while( $data = @mysqli_fetch_array( $this->rs ) ) { $tempArray[$i] = $data ; $i++; } return $tempArray ; } function sql_value($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); if( $this->rs ) { $row = $this->rs->fetch_row(); return $row[0]; } else echo $query." : ERROR : ".mysqli_error($this->mysqli); } function selectRow($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); if( $this->rs ) return @mysqli_fetch_array( $this->rs ); else echo $query." : ERROR : ".mysqli_error($this->mysqli); } function count($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= @mysqli_num_rows( $this->rs ); return $row; } function row($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= @mysqli_fetch_array( $this->rs ); return $row; } function fetch_row($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= @mysqli_fetch_row( $this->rs ); return $row; } function num_rows($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= @mysqli_num_rows( $this->rs ); return $row; } function insert_id(){ $temp_number = mysqli_insert_id($this->mysqli); return $temp_number; } function exist($db_table_name) { $que = "SELECT COUNT(*) FROM information_schema.tables WHERE table_schema = '".$this->db."' AND table_name = '".$db_table_name."';"; $exist_out = $this->get_once( $que ); return $exist_out; } function db_close() { if ($this->rs) { @mysqli_free_result( $this->rs ); } if ($this->mysqli){ @mysqli_close(); } } function total_row($query) { $this->connect(); $this->rs = @mysqli_query($this->mysqli,$query); $row = @mysqli_num_rows( $this->rs ); return $row; } } $db = new mydb($dbCon); function escape_string ($fillter,$chk_trim="0") { GLOBAL $dbCon; if ( $chk_trim == 1 ) { $fillter = trim($fillter); } $link = mysqli_connect($dbCon['dbHost'], $dbCon['dbUid'], $dbCon['dbPw'], $dbCon['db']); $fillter = mysqli_real_escape_string($link, $fillter ); return $fillter; } 

Did this file decode correctly?

Original Code

eval(gzinflate(base64_decode('DVZF0oRqsl1O3xsMcCiiowcU7g4Fkxe4O3zI6t+/gjyZx7IE6fBP/bZTNaRH+U+W7iVF/F9R5nNR/vOfKsxkfj1iAWB51SJRI5xUCiJOFq5n1OtEiJHbyu1f9waVoR7eFixyEajhmVbHBFcMle7YL9/hKFsD0x6reX/kGbyveNMBuuQYl09fuu2rFAyjyEFHlcmQJb6BFgBULTYfLZW3mrIcF7whrMLgbqfx9F+JTk+7T5un9aWfaGisILA6jpeUT64bVzTDIrJTDLgAqzP2IhjgBYwxNzXAOiaC+s5NfnW2Kp4dR7zAZFe2u6apO+Dnbd1zUQy5yNr103uust0qsbmGTp+NHc1uI6tdAzPn97FBf3wvwT/WzQctjnzoybzTqh9kZEUGjY7aL6neXjeHX2I0EKHrTegThmKEJLdzBijjNVTq8wXstpQHoQ+VyxG4w4WKneWjovjvmNdQh7Fm+0izMbhBQOsysWqLLP6qyqu6IGyVXdJIe0livOjWvYuClTHC3wrqILnUPk47mkhznQ3709e+zJCUd7VA0rtjnftADYV8q6vdno/wtXE8vz16XdWNJ55+YK25rv9Oc0Nqm7sQsXPzhmJ8urtxHeQpJIcPeOyJf4ln83I9ife05A+fqK5ipwwHsbOnZGRD3OTSnSE5RpSsj5Henb5c8euVU2ssx4/Gojrhj/QrTH3fGwtb1zTBcY7F+cKOopAcPV1kOlzYxTP7EnpVRKCZaRBgv4bTWvSu3EFQ2k9bV9+E0+9vtYJPtQpPL+19EVrRXPiQG4c8iZ5eYMkY2nnR6fOsYXmseVPuJiHQdyomBcrKlt7bTyRJz91J1Hj4GDiRHWTqaQW9KnzAWKFQK+mWfUXNAV7e2EmFPnkFaunr48aVjM+8MR6SBX7OCqyQLBe/FvK+xbbvCmi4sjEWUrtRadtyJsboqUFPGRiZHlYOs46Jp17OK9s1ky/VmVm8eWoPGRCDpUEfZVCtW6TvwCfNHvOcSNztJT+lQvJIDPNPcsheZaSV3FNOrX2/02QiBh4jjCK6TvX463fZwTXL4uYDv1CCKrboChNDCQnYc0Glw/32nfjdh+Fv8aP53iuvL0Z0gIUJsV0c1xUPHJmA2qvoBmpk6T6gvSjHQzuVJxUoTYD+9ry8nGgwZSeK4EFmT9F0f5VcSEuUqsKz7u48OQE5oU+cTbwavwRrtJ96RqSD4cus62PS/AxRmBpy6PpVvl5AJrB83CT9rvuXaIXDgJ31u4H2Fn1Y++PJO6bRa80ctFIINvCLUl0ekqVZOfbqTH09mHn7LNEc4lZQNLxuAZzQsy952pO2AXu5T272Aplr2/l4XKuc3mEUzispQ9yOimesRbogWpFUQuTT4QhSebOhU1fXz5ZGxggs2dXndLi5YxfvXsiFCLfDSLhFe2zwIKI+QligNpiNn7lpF45wWN5X/673w9VDwmaIMJU/Ya+UDB2NSpwY7Uc9anClDpiGcMH37HbJCx8vYxP12118tUb/SCMvusIPNoCHorsKHvBaOee/6nxm7d4pxa1q6DeCPL6eVXETEyxbBhV6f0HIDFaUWDRReLZDeTfRe2FwuK6bmY0f1UnXPP7YbIdD13jujKfubOkxvFrttrN7IQvsAkyjBLnQvhYjFMD6sC2JBVhXHUx2QKrTK46PwStfRkngvS7zBAR5n/ucNmMJukHYmZVxMZgkvz+jhtTIUJGhr4c9cD9YDMHTgeZlYaOkJ5/ESWCJn6f4w54bvjOWdwgdID9BFN+9ty5kI0wyJimXj2c2CfpR+zP3Ub73PprXqga6kBH7w5u1BsNjcPEBrNNnU1Gq6WehLDOJd/WuRCOHjOT0n51WYUznVlobL8Petxq9w+td4xYIRl/tLm5X4lMIU7shm/v9SurCyg39WPxyhA//PLK4AwvYr0/ewYJ833WYhCc2WoqPTkkNV98ZGJmOClcMoFsuwIYdse35t2cjU7s8gnImxELL7WDwg3VQO9FNs2OB7rHQs0lVKG56u+WmNSJs87ty4C+9xunIB2ngTI0fWeh3B+hliYG5NZAqIZkvJTCtb465RAbB8ZVqjAXG2otlb2iAaw853BjDkqSfEtdfFUoUPY7StoYxxCVbLdiYvGmokANg6a1jVPUDj7HhakskaW4InDS9GdYYF+dXRiN1woNCcJYZWuhRlcmfolBJVCFGw0FEd5+t5KgcinoFDsIolkTkFQiVurHX0MVIcv2uodiwbBT3qbEEJ8WbBHDaVRLlJOrq1uXSNprY71H3tASEO91b496M56czu8TFRsHo616WVW3gxOT2OyFPiMfJlbzBZtIqnJc2/xvCYSVbdMRbYBmjL+mman94UrNWrhhjx/lMm9Mz86bxz6ANlAkNYANaMnRmkw+ZtAoGTO5gNdy/dvC0Jj9gIq9U+W17n0igCInrF2jWydBkoQb6OHLKdIH1glY3u9wXLH7juK0gGbaXOG027bghNdGIlGQ8kQ1Ui0VnpkY77/NhhzH7qyu3vROx9rw8ppYg/hDqxwNoI4lHJlR3mf0edOiwfuDm6X77njEjKsEjgGgwgTIMDMOoDf3gSl/gfVIUxvjGfx8OYridIA8gJ7PyGKgH2o+SAKgtsSQDwvu4Tb8MbgYFv/WGNvo7y/T2NbdhcKveBDauLzfH03iMbvxPzLEZt+merS3i98pi5147xt/hqFZuQ4ga4p2/bX9SGBFIAPgPrWOq3cEAxyuSh7nrf//7z7///vvf/wc=')));

Function Calls

strtr 1
gzinflate 4
base64_decode 5

Variables

$__Ai6JgCjnSE require_once($_SERVER[DOCUMENT_ROOT]."/INC/dbconf.php"); c..

Stats

MD5 df13cfe54350b25f4c2b31658f1f8cd9
Eval Count 5
Decode Time 59 ms